What is AR Automation?
Understanding Accounts Receivable Automation
AR automation refers to the use of technology, artificial intelligence (AI), and workflow automation tools to streamline the entire accounts receivable process — from invoice generation to payment collection and reconciliation.
Key Components of AR Automation
Invoice Processing Automation
Automates invoice creation, delivery, and tracking across digital channels.
Cash Application
Matches incoming payments with open invoices using AI-driven reconciliation.
Collections Automation
Uses automated reminders, workflows, and prioritization to improve collections efficiency.
Dispute Management
Identifies and resolves invoice disputes quickly with minimal manual intervention.

How AR Automation Works
Step 1: Data Capture and Integration
AR automation platforms integrate with ERP, CRM, and billing systems to capture invoice and customer data.
Step 2: Intelligent Invoice Delivery
Invoices are sent automatically via email, portals, or electronic invoicing systems.
Step 3: Automated Collections Workflows
AI prioritizes customers based on risk and payment behavior, triggering personalized reminders.
Step 4: Payment Matching and Reconciliation
Payments are automatically matched with invoices using machine learning algorithms.
Step 5: Analytics and Reporting
Dashboards provide insights into KPIs like DSO, aging reports, and collection effectiveness.
